Are there any countries where you don't have to pay taxes on cryptocurrency?
Is it possible to find a country where you can enjoy the benefits of cryptocurrency without having to worry about paying taxes on it? Are there any jurisdictions that have implemented favorable tax policies for cryptocurrency holders?
3 answers
- sammyMay 12, 2022 · 4 years agoWhile there are no countries that completely exempt cryptocurrency from taxes, some jurisdictions have implemented more favorable tax policies for cryptocurrency holders. For example, countries like Malta, Switzerland, and Portugal have introduced tax regulations that are more lenient towards cryptocurrencies. However, it's important to note that even in these countries, certain tax obligations may still apply, such as capital gains tax or income tax on cryptocurrency transactions. It's always recommended to consult with a tax professional or legal advisor to understand the specific tax regulations in your jurisdiction.
- Julia MayrhauserOct 05, 2020 · 5 years agoUnfortunately, there is no country that completely exempts cryptocurrency from taxes. However, some countries have implemented more favorable tax policies for cryptocurrency holders. For instance, Malta has introduced a Virtual Financial Assets Act that provides a regulatory framework for cryptocurrencies and offers tax benefits for individuals and businesses involved in the cryptocurrency industry. Similarly, Switzerland has a progressive tax system that allows for certain tax exemptions for cryptocurrencies. It's important to research and understand the tax regulations in each specific country before making any assumptions or decisions regarding taxes on cryptocurrency.
